1. Man runs onto baseball field during ran delay, slides on water-filled tarp

    Man runs onto baseball field during ran delay, slides on water-filled tarp

    2
    0
    1.96K
  2. Ingenious Way Of Catching Termites For Food In Kenya

    Ingenious Way Of Catching Termites For Food In Kenya

    180
    23
    9.81K
    79
  3. Tiny dog challenges massive horse to tug-of-war match

    Tiny dog challenges massive horse to tug-of-war match

    3
    0
    4.48K
    1